Fire Dragon Roar

Fire Dragon Roar is one of Natsu's signature moves, which he learned from his foster father, the Fire Dragon Slayer Igneel. This spell involves Natsu gathering a large amount of fire in his mouth before releasing it in a powerful burst of flames towards his opponent. The sheer force and intensity of the attack make it a formidable weapon in Natsu's arsenal, capable of causing massive destruction and overwhelming his enemies.

One of the key features of Fire Dragon Roar is its versatility. Natsu can control the direction and intensity of the flames, allowing him to adapt to different combat situations and target multiple opponents at once. The spell's range and destructive power make it a go-to move for Natsu when facing formidable foes or engaging in intense battles where brute force is required.

Another notable aspect of Fire Dragon Roar is its ability to ignite objects and surroundings upon impact. The flames produced by the spell are not only hot but also have a burning effect, making them ideal for setting enemies or obstacles ablaze. This additional element of fire manipulation adds a strategic advantage to Natsu's attacks, as he can create barriers or traps using the fiery aftermath of the spell.

Overall, Fire Dragon Roar is a classic and reliable spell in Natsu's repertoire, known for its raw power, versatility, and destructive capabilities. It embodies the essence of a Fire Dragon Slayer's magic, showcasing Natsu's fiery spirit and determination in battle.
